¿Por qué Acceso anticipado?

“WM:ToTD was designed from day 1 with Early Access in mind. It's an ambitious project for two devs, and one which we feel is particularly suited to themed content updates. We've already built the skeleton of the game's main storyline, and we've got plans for more dungeons, abilities, encounters, talents, and the full roster of playable characters. All of these things could be delivered in thematic content releases, and be shaped by our Early Access community.”

¿Cuánto tiempo va a estar este juego en Acceso anticipado aproximadamente?

“We hope to be finished with Early Access within 18-20 months of initial launch. However, we may stretch this if we feel that additional polish is required.”

¿Qué tan diferente será la versión completa de la versión de Acceso anticipado?

“There are six investigators currently missing from the game's line-up of playable characters, and only a small fraction of the intended spells, abilities and items. Our goal is to add this missing content in regular content patches, along with additional areas, dungeons, cutscenes, and combat improvements. The full version of the game is expected to be about 10-13 hours long, with plenty of replay value.”

¿Cuál es el estado actual de la versión de Acceso anticipado?

“You can play the first chapter of the campaign, which includes three regions: The Beach, The Sewers, and the Crawlspace Wastes - although the third one is not yet complete. Six of the twelve playable characters are in-game. However, there's still a lot of missing content and character customisation. Many of the game's spells and abilities are not yet in-game, which means that magic use is quite limited at this time. The game's opening sequence is in need of custom artwork and polish. Combat is fun and stable, but as we mentioned, missing lots of customisation.”

¿El precio del juego será diferente durante y después del Acceso anticipado?

“The price will remain the same.”

¿Cómo tienes planeado involucrar a la comunidad en tu proceso de desarrollo?

“The team is active on Discord, and new channels have been added to help us listen to Early Access feedback. The game has already been in the hands of select Kickstarter backers for over a year, and we've been enjoying listening to their thoughts and ideas. We've also delivered 4 major updates via the Steam Play-test, so we have experience shipping major updates and hotfixes. We look forward to expanding this process to a wider audience.”

Acerca de este juego

Drugged, robbed, hexed, and thrown into Boston Harbor like so much damp tea. All in all, not the best start to your career as a private detective.

Witchmarsh: Tea Party of the Damned is a short, party-based RPG set in the 1920s. Players create a team of investigators and lead them through a subterranean mega-dungeon, hidden beneath the streets of Jazz Age New England.

  • Tactical action-RPG combat. Pause the fight and issue commands to your teammates, or swap between party members on the fly.

  • A huge roster of playable characters, each with their own unique playstyle and personality. Detect hidden items as the Trapper, interrogate underworld denizens as the PI, or hurl your team-mates through the air as the Moose.

  • An authentic Jazz Age soundtrack by composer Francisco Cerda (Gunpoint, Jamestown).

  • In-depth character creation. Customise your investigators with a range of attributes, skills and abilities.

  • A rich branching dialogue system, complete with attribute tests and hidden story content.

  • Wield firearms, darts and magic spells, or get up close and personal with knuckledusters, blackjacks and daggers.

It's the Roaring Twenties, and a series of mysterious vanishings has shaken the town of Witchmarsh. As private detectives, you'd arrived in Boston with hopes of securing the case, but there's one thing you didn't count on... being poisoned, cursed, and cast down into an eldritch plane of existence by a gang of felonious warlocks.

It's always something in this business, isn't it?

You awaken on an underground beach, suffering what seems to be the mother of all hangovers. All of your possessions are gone. With the help of a fellow traveller, you set out in search of a cure, but there's no time to lose: one false step and you'll be banished to this stygian realm for all eternity.

Who were your assailants, and why are they casting their victims into the underworld? Is your guide, the elusive Shelby, hiding something? Why is there a haunted speakeasy 300 feet below Boston Harbor? And what's more, will you ever see the surface world again?

The denizens of the underworld aren't just going to let you mosey through their domain in search of an antidote. Tea Party of the Damned features devious enemies and deadly boss fights, including:

  • A skeleton stick-up crew.

  • Giant insects, floating books and dust-loving jelly-men.

  • Cultists, grave-robbers and ghosts.

  • Streetwise fire elementals.

  • Mutant sea anemones.

  • ... and many more!

Explore a strange, subterranean world, with four distinct regions. Meet extra-dimensional beings, and rest your weary bones at the Journey's End saloon.

Although Tea Party of the Damned will be single-player at launch, we plan on patching in full online multiplayer after release. Thanks for being patient with us while we get this up and running!
